Lengthening and Strengthening: The goal of Pilates is to make muscles longer and stronger at the same time. This helps give people who do it regularly that long, lean, and toned look. It builds muscle endurance and makes your body look balanced instead of just building muscle mass on its own.

One of the great things about Pilates is that it can target a variety of muscle groups, all while using your own body weight as resistance.
When you move with control, your muscles stay engaged for longer periods of time. This is what helps build endurance and tone. It also means you're using the right muscles for each movement rather than relying on momentum or overcompensating with stronger areas.
